Lyric Hammersmith Theatre seeks Director of Communications & Sales

Closing Date: 31 August 2021

Lyric Hammersmith Theatre

Location: Hammersmith, London

Remuneration: £45,000 per annum

Description

The Lyric Hammersmith is one of the UK’s leading producing theatres. The Lyric produces world class theatre from the heart of Hammersmith, the theatre’s home for more than a hundred and twenty five years. The theatre has gained a national reputation for its work in forging pathways into the arts for young talent from all backgrounds.

We are now recruiting for a Director of Communications & Sales who will lead the development and delivery of the Lyric’s communications, marketing, sales and audience development strategies. As a member of the Lyric’s Senior Management Team, the Director of Communications & Sales plays a central role in income generation for the theatre with responsibility for brand, reputation and advocacy.

We are looking for a creative and imaginative strategist with experience of creating, implementing and evaluating effective marketing campaigns.

Deadline for applications: 10am Tuesday 31 August 2021.

The Lyric encourages people from any background to apply for this post. We are committed to creating a workforce which is representative of our society, and to bringing together those with a variety of skills and experiences to help shape what we do and how we work. We are particularly keen to hear from people of colour or those who self-identify as disabled. All candidates that self-identify as disabled and who demonstrate that they meet the essential criteria will be invited for an interview. The Lyric Hammersmith is proud to be a Disability Confident Committed Employer and an official partner of Parents in Performing Arts (PiPA).
